What
We Do
The process of
inspecting a home is a
crucial one. Many buyers
purchase their home on
impulse and find themselves
suffering from buyers
remorse upon discovering
serious flaws in the home
itself. At Accurate
Inspections, we provide our
clients with the tools they
need to make an educated
choice regarding the
quality and condition of
their potential new home,
we inspect for common
home defects and not so
common ones. By hiring an experienced NJ Certified home inspector
who has your
best interest solely in
mind, our clients are
better able to judge the
strengths and weaknesses of
the home in which they are
under contract to buy and help avoid home buyer's remorse. We
will inspect the structure,
exterior,
drainage,
grounds,
roof,
plumbing,
electric,
heating,
thermostats,
ac,
interior
and fireplace.
The municipality will
inspect the smoke
alarms. We will provide
home
maintenance suggestions and safety
tips. Our web site also
provides information about NJ septic inspections,
a Walk
through home inspection checklist, what
to look for when you look
for a home and a list
of Questions
to ask during a home inspection.
All clients of Accurate
Inspections are encouraged
to attend their NJ Certified home inspection,
they also receive a
subscription to our quarterly
news letter and a
custom type written report
detailing our observations,
what is wrong, why it is
wrong, what do about
it and recommendations of
useful upgrades to the
property systems. If items
are found that are unsafe,
hazardous or require
further evaluation by an
expert, the report tells
you so in plain English.
Our report is designed to
help you save money as well
provide peace of mind in
your new investment. We also provide radon
measurement, test
well water and provide PWTA
tests.
